Несколько методов, которые могут ускорить конвертацию больших массивов шестнадцатеричных данных в двоичный формат:
- Использование таблиц соответствия. ecalc.ru sky.pro Предопределённая таблица соответствия шестнадцатеричных символов может значительно ускорить процесс преобразования. sky.pro
- Разбиение задачи на более мелкие части. ecalc.ru При работе с большими числами это позволяет упростить расчёты. ecalc.ru
- Преобразование входных символов из ASCII в числовые значения. stackoverflow.com Для этого можно использовать вычитание: если символ находится между «0» и «9», то нужно вычесть 48, если между «a» и «f» — 88. stackoverflow.com
- Использование специальных программ. github.com Например, «hex2bin» позволяет конвертировать файлы в формате Intel hex в двоичный формат. github.com
Для перевода шестнадцатеричных чисел в двоичные можно использовать онлайн-калькуляторы, например на сайте ecalc.ru. ecalc.ru